#207036 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#207036 is composed of 12.5% red, 43.9%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.8%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 136.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 28.2%. #207036 color hex could be obtained by blending #40e06c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#207036 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#207036 has RGB values of R:32, G:112,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 2125878.

Shades and Tints of #207036
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010503 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#207036
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474947 is the less saturated color, while #048c2a is the most saturated one.
